Generally raise pre flop if opening. Call or re-raise if there's been action before you depending on how you've seen your opponents play and what you're trying to achieve in the hand.

Bear in mind KQ KJ could be a bit dodgy especially if you're playing after a raise or if you get re-raised as you're often already behind to AK, AQ, AJ. You can lose a lot of money on those hands.

If you're just starting out don't limp either raise or fold if it's unopened when the action gets to you.

Don't play scared money. Drop down to stakes your comfortable playing.

If you have $47 in your account you should NOT be playing $1/$2 cash. The general rule of thumb for cash games is that you should have between 20 and 30 buy ins for the stakes you are playing. I.e. the normal buy in for $1/$2 is $200. You should have approximately $4,000 to $6,000 in your account to justify playing this level. This is why you play 'different' at the higher stakes.... because your playing with everything in your account and its therefore 'scared' money. Based on the hand scenarios you have given and the questions you have asked you should be playing as small stakes as possible till you grasp the game a bit more, otherwise you will most likely lose a lot of money.

Try playing $0.02/$0.05 cash games or $3 sit n goes and try and build up your bankroll as you learn.
